Police in Mokwakaila search for missing 7-year-old boy who went missing over the weekend

The Police in Mokwakwaila outside Tzaneen have launched a search operation for a 7-year-old boy who has been reported missing over the weekend.
It is alleged that the boy, Gift Mathibela left home on Saturday, 26 November 2022 at about 13:00 and never returned back after playing with other children at Mokgwathi village.
Gift was last seen wearing a pink t-shirt with black shorts and red cap without shoes.
A search team comprises of the police, members of the family and the community was formed to locate the missing boy with no success.
It is alleged that during the search processes some clothes including a cap, pair of trousers and a t-shirt were found in the river which were ultimately being identified by the family of the missing boy.
The SAPS Search and Rescue team has been deployed in the search operation and investigations are continuing.
